Transaction 320cec66b8546bb77acd0d0ee1450b106df1490a75a2ae884fe6764098af6318
1 Input
1 Output
-
320cec66b8546bb77acd0d0ee1450b106df1490a75a2ae884fe6764098af6318:0
- value
- 471488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26ca41d0046484e1d01f4264a4b07a0feb31b1e0 OP_EQUAL
- address
- 35E7tuFJGWWoZYsyYUAFj4P9YLaAWZXqiw